
Native Forest Organic Chunks Pineapple
What You Should Know
Native Forest Organic Chunks Pineapple (14 oz) reads like a pantry-friendly slice of tropical sunshine: field-ripened organic pineapple pieces packed in their own organic juice and sealed in a shelf-stable can. In the supermarket you’ll find it in the canned fruit aisle alongside other canned and jarred fruits, near pie fillings, cocktail cherries and baking staples — sometimes cross-stocked with baking or holiday ingredients for convenience. It’s the kind of product shoppers toss into carts on grocery runs for brunch toppings, holiday baking, or simple snacks for kids. Native Forest positions itself as a family-owned, vegetarian-friendly brand with an organic, sustainability-forward story; its label leans on an organic certification, “nothing added” language and pastoral copy about soil and small farms to evoke a wholesome, responsibly grown image. The packaging is utilitarian — a printed metal can with a cheerful label — and the ritual is straightforward: open, drain or use the sweet juice, and add pineapple chunks to yogurt, smoothies, cakes, fruit salads, or baked goods. Sensory-wise the fruit is tender, juicy and consistently sweet with a bright, slightly tart finish; the texture is softer than fresh pineapple due to canning and heating, which makes it ideal for baking or easy snacking. In plain terms this is a processed, shelf-stable product (heat-treated and canned to preserve freshness) rather than raw produce. Overall it sells convenience and organic credibility — a practical, family-friendly option when fresh pineapple isn’t available or when long shelf life and easy prep matter.

Ultra-Processing Assessment
Processed Food
Why this score?
The product contains only organic pineapple and organic pineapple juice but is heat-treated and canned for preservation; this places it in NOVA group 3 as a processed food rather than an unprocessed fresh fruit or an ultra-processed formulation.
